This week, Judge Seibel dismissed a putative class action against the makers of Muscle Milk and other protein powder products.  The plaintiff alleged that the products were mislabeled under the Food, Drug, and Cosmetic Act, as they contained unnecessary empty space (or “slack fill”) that represented up to 30% of the container’s volume.

Judge Seibel found that these allegations alone – without further factual support – were not sufficient to survive a motion to dismiss:
